Load-break/Load-make switches can switch normal system load currents; Isolators are off load disconnectors which are to be operated after Circuit Breakers, or else if the load current is very small; By voltage class: Low voltage (less than 1 kV AC) Medium voltage (1 kV AC through to approximately 75 kV AC) High voltage (75 kV to about 230 kV AC)
In 1966, devices were developed with a rated voltage of 15 kV and short-circuit breaking currents of 25 and 31.5 kA. After the 1970s, vacuum switches began to replace the minimal-oil switches in medium-voltage switchgear. In the early 1980s, SF6 switches and breakers were also gradually replaced by vacuum technology in medium-voltage application.
Each key of a computer keyboard, for example, is a normally-open "push-to-make" switch. A "push-to-break" (or normally-closed or NC) switch, on the other hand, breaks contact when the button is pressed and makes contact when it is released. An example of a push-to-break switch is a button used to release a door held closed by an electromagnet.

A solid state relay (SSR) is an electronic switching device that switches on or off when an external voltage (AC or DC) is applied across its control terminals. They serve the same function as an electromechanical relay , but solid-state electronics contain no moving parts and have a longer operational lifetime.
A braking chopper is an magnetical switch that limits the DC bus voltage by switching the braking energy to a resistor where the braking energy is converted to heat. Braking choppers are automatically activated when the actual DC bus voltage exceeds a specified level depending on the nominal voltage of the variable-frequency drive
